request, commission
Asking someone to do something; placing an order for a service.
仕事の依頼を受けた。
I received a job request.
専門家に調査を依頼する。
To request an expert to conduct an investigation.
依頼主からの連絡を待つ。
To wait for contact from the client.
友達に引っ越しの手伝いを依頼した。
I asked a friend to help with moving.
お客さまからの依頼が多くて、今週はとても忙しい。
There are so many requests from clients that this week is very busy.
依頼 is a formal way to express requesting something.
COMMON PATTERNS:
- 依頼する (to request, commission)
- 依頼を受ける (to receive a request)
- 〜に依頼する (to request from ~)
COMPOUND WORDS:
- 依頼者/依頼主 (client, requester)
- 依頼書 (written request)
- 依頼内容 (details of request)
FORMALITY:
- More formal than 頼む (to ask)
- Used in business and professional contexts
SIMILAR WORDS:
- 頼む: to ask (casual)
- 要請: request (formal, official)
- 注文: order (for products)
